Ebora Owu,Visits Olubadans Family.

Former President Obasanjo in the early hours of 06:01:2022 visited the family of the late olubadan of Ibadan Oba Saliu Akanmu Adetunji, Aje Ogungunniso1

Obasanjo was welcome at the Popoyemoja Palace of late Monarch,by Chief Nureni Akanbi,Balogun, and Olori

The former President was accompanied to the palace by a former Secretary to the Government of Oyo State, Chief Olayiwola Olakojo

In his brief, Chief Obasanjo prayed for the repose of the soul of the departed Ibadan monarch and pledged his readiness to assist the family at any time whenever the need arises.
